According to physician Dr. Steven Quay, whose post Trump Jr. shared, prostate cancer is one of the most detectable cancers when caught early.
“The easiest cancer to diagnose when it first starts and to watch it progress to bone metastases,” Quay said.
Doctors discovered the cancer after Biden reportedly began experiencing “increasing urinary symptoms.”
A subsequent medical evaluation revealed a “small nodule” on his prostate, which led to the devastating diagnosis of metastatic cancer, meaning it had already spread to his bones.
The White House made the news public on Sunday, only days after confirming that Biden had undergone further evaluation.
Medical experts, including Quay, say the timeline doesn’t add up. In his analysis, Quay stated, “For even with the most aggressive form, it is a five to seven year journey without treatment before it becomes metastatic.”
“Meaning it would be malpractice for this patient to show up and first be diagnosed with metastatic disease in May 2025,” he continued.
The doctor went further, suggesting that the cancer may have been present for years, potentially even during Biden’s time in the Oval Office.
“It is highly likely he was carrying a diagnosis of prostate cancer throughout his White House tenure and the American people were uninformed,” Quay claimed.
That viewpoint was echoed by Dr. Howie Forman, a professor at Yale with expertise in radiology and public health.
Forman said it was “inconceivable that this was not being followed before he left the Presidency,” pointing to standard PSA tests, which typically reveal prostate issues well in advance of severe progression.
Formman noted that Biden “must have had a PSA test numerous times before,” calling the late-stage diagnosis “odd.”
